The 2010 Mercury Mariner Premier comes in two trim levels: Premier I4 and Premier V6. The Premier I4 comes with standard features that include 16-inch 12-spoke alloy wheels, air conditioning, foglights, privacy glass and a six-speaker CD stereo with auxiliary jack. Ford’s SYNC system with 911 Assist and GPS functions, heated front seats, leather upholstery and ambient interior lighting add a touch of class to the Mariner without breaking the bank. The Premier V6 offers all the I4’s standard features, plus a powerful six-cylinder engine.
Available options include a variety of packages that include features like 17-inch wheels, a backup camera, step bars, dual-zone climate control and a sophisticated Auto Park system that will automatically steer your Mariner Premier while parallel parking. Other optional features include Alcantara upholstery, an awesome seven-speaker audio system with SIRIUS Travel Link and traffic reports, plus an internal hard drive that serves as the navigation system and offers music storage.
The Mariner Premier stores a lot more than music, too. Its roomy, comfortable cabin is well-equipped with plenty of handy, secure storage spaces. With the rear seat up, the Mariner offers a generous 31.4 cubic feet of cargo space; with the rear seat down, cargo room expands to 67.2 cubic feet – more than enough for a weekend trip to the hardware store or even an extended vacation trip.
Both the Premier I4 and V6 are available with front- or all-wheel drive. The I4’s inline four-cylinder engine delivers 171 hp and 171 lb/ft of torque while the V6 edition generates 240 hp and 223 lb/ft of torque. Both versions come with six-speed automatic transmissions. With Mercury’s Tow Package, the Mercury Premier V6 can pull up to 3,500 pounds—perfect for camping, boating or snowmobiling. The I4 edition is rated up to 26 mpg.
Safety is another important reason the Mariner is one of the most popular vehicles in its class. The Mercury Mariner earned the highest-possible five stars in government testing for front and side crash safety, and the highest rating of “Good” in the Insurance Institute for Highway Safety’s frontal offset and side crash tests. Standard safety features on the Mariner Premier editions include Mercury’s Personal Safety System with a variety of airbags and other safety technology, antilock brakes, AdvanceTrac® with Roll Stability Control™ and rollover sensors.
And when it comes to safety, Mercury especially has new drivers in mind: among the Mariner’s most unique safety features is the MyKey™ system, which improves the safety of younger, more inexperienced drivers by limiting top speeds and stereo volume.
